Why the Digital Wine (ASX:DW8) share price is up an astonishing 18%

The Digital Wine Ventures Ltd (ASX: DW8) share price hit a 5-year high of 9.5 cents in morning trade. At the time of writing, shares in the online beverage distributor are selling at 9.1 cents, up 18% on yesterday’s close. This rise occurred after the company announced massive increases on one of its sales platforms.
In comparison, the S&P/ASX All Ordinaries Index is up only 0.7% in morning trade.
Let’s take a closer look at what’s sent the Digital Wine share price soaring today.
What did Digital Wine announce today?
